Itinerary Highlights
The Banff tour takes explorers on a captivating journey through the region’s natural wonders. At Lake Minnewanka, visitors can embark on scenic boat tours, explore hiking trails, and try their hand at fishing. Nearby, Johnson Lake offers a peaceful respite for picnicking, swimming, and leisurely strolls. The tour then ascends to the top of Sulphur Mountain via the Banff Gondola, where panoramic views and informative exhibits await. Guests can also indulge in the mineral-rich waters of the Banff Upper Hot Springs, surrounded by the majestic mountain scenery. The tour culminates with free time in Banff’s vibrant downtown, perfect for shopping, dining, and soaking in the town’s charming atmosphere.

Sulphur Mountain Viewpoints
Towering above Banff’s charming downtown, Sulphur Mountain beckons adventurers to ascend its rugged slopes and witness the breathtaking panorama.
The Banff Gondola whisks visitors up to the summit, where they’re rewarded with a 360-degree view of snow-capped peaks, glacial lakes, and the winding Bow River below.
Informative exhibits at the mountaintop provide insight into the region’s geology and wildlife, while hiking trails offer a chance to explore the alpine environment firsthand.
